Offshore development provides access to a wider talent pool, helping organizations overcome local hiring challenges such as high salary demands and limited specialized skills. This strategy is not solely about cost reduction; it also brings flexibility and the ability to scale systems in response to evolving market needs.
Teams based in different countries often manage various aspects of software projects, including application development and system maintenance. By leveraging the expertise of offshore developers, companies can complement their internal teams instead of replacing them, thus achieving better outcomes.
Modern projects frequently require niche skills in areas like mobile technology and cybersecurity. Specialized offshore teams can offer knowledge that would take considerable time and resources to develop in-house, making this approach increasingly attractive for many businesses.
